Nolan's 'Dunkirk' on Home Video in December
24 Oct, 2017 By: John Latchem
Warner Bros. Home Entertainment will release director Christopher Nolan’s acclaimed World War II epic Dunkirk on Digital HD Dec. 12, and on DVD, Blu-ray and 4K Ultra HD Blu-ray with high dynamic range Dec. 19.
Dunkirk relays several interconnected stories of British and Allied troops trapped on the beach at Dunkirk, France, awaiting evacuation as the enemy closes in. The film’s cast includes Fionn Whitehead, Tom Glynn-Carney, Jack Lowden, Harry Styles, Aneurin Barnard, James D’Arcy and Barry Keoghan, with Kenneth Branagh, Cillian Murphy, Mark Rylance and Tom Hardy.
The film earned $187.7 million at the domestic box office.
Nolan directed Dunkirk from his own original screenplay, utilizing a mixture of Imax and 65mm film to bring the story to the screen. The film was partially shot on location on the beaches of Dunkirk.
Extras include several behind-the-scenes featurettes.
